Velodyne Optimum Subwoofers Introduced

516711.jpg

The Optimum Series subwoofers from Velodyne Acoustics, the world’s leading manufacturer of powered subwoofers, offer a new level of simplicity and ease-of-use to provide the ultimate bass performance. With immediate visual feedback from the Optimum subs, in a beautiful contoured cabinet, the user can easily and quickly balance the subwoofer and adjust for any source material. The Optimum is the perfect blend of elegant styling, bass performance and power.

Users can make adjustments of their subwoofer using the included remote control with instantaneous feedback from the intuitive, interactive front panel display. One push of the “EQ” button on the remote and the seven-band, Auto-EQ room bass correction system, using DSP technology, will quickly adjust the sub for the best bass performance, regardless of placement. Use the remote control to adjust the volume, turn on or off the front LED, adjust phase or limit output for late night listening and view the results on the front panel. The remote control also includes four one-touch listening presets for customized listening. The mic-input jack is located on the front panel along with the power switch.

All three models in the Optimum Series (Optimum-8, Optimum-10 and Optimum-12) are powered by a Class D switching amplifier delivering 1200 watts RMS and 2400 watts dynamic power. The drivers incorporate light, stiff Kevlar-reinforced resin cones, massive 21 lb. magnet structures (on the Optimum-10 and Optimum-12), and 2.5″ to 3″ copper wound voice coils and vented pole pieces. The elegant contoured cabinet is available in either a high-gloss, black piano lacquer finish or real cherry veneer.

“We’ve created extreme bass performance for the home that’s easy to understand and use, in a beautiful sub using quality craftsmanship that can be shown off, but is small enough to fit into any application,” said Bruce Hall, president of Velodyne. “It’s the perfect combination that will please the most demanding audio customer.”

The Optimum Series has a suggested retail price of $1,299 for the Optimum-8, $1,699 for the Optimum-10, and $1899 for the Optimum-12.
